Chevereto 2.4.3 (2012-10-09) release notes
- Fixed issue with short url (external)
- Fixed not working preferences cookie
- Fixed issues with IE 7 and 9 (CSS)
- Added Kurdish (ku) language support

Update from 2.4.2 | Affected files & folders
- includes/chevereto.php
- content/system/js/pref.php
- content/languages/ku
- content/themes/Peafowl/style.css
- content/themes/Peafowl/style.min.css

Ajax uploader means a system to upload using php (or any server side) + javascript instead of flash. And that will appear on 2.6
 
Yes, but what's better about it?

Flash is a technology which depends on a company called Adobe, which help the web to grow the last decade allowing anything from video sharing websites (youtube), online music players (grooveshark), games, etc. Problem with flash is that is old technology and there are better alternatives now. For instance, this is the list of problems of using a flash uploader:
  • Browser must have the flash plugin (iOS don't have flash player).
  • Flash runs the upload process as a separate client request which means that you have workaround the session ids.
  • Flash can't be fully customized because it runs compiled swf files. You can't easily style or change behaviors.
  • Flash depends on Adobe, which means that Adobe is complete free to add/remove flash functionalities that may affect your compiled swf file.
Don't take me wrong, flash can do a lot of things better than javascript but the technology allows us now to do without flash things and let us be more free to customize and develop. That's why the flash uploader must be changed for a JavaScript solution.
